How Fidelity Treasury Bills Actually Work

Fidelity Treasury Bills are short-term government obligations issued by the U.S. Treasury, designed to carry maturities as short as a few days up to one year. Unlike stocks or bonds, they are sold at a discount and mature at par, making them a liquid, low-volatility investment. Investors ecced directly at minimal risk, as they’re fully backed by the U.S. government, with no credit concern.

When purchased, the difference between purchase price and payout at maturity reflects the interest earned—transparent, predictable, and free from complex features. Common Questions About Fidelity Treasury Bills

H3: Are Fidelity Treasury Bills safe?
Yes. Backed 100% by the federal government, they are among the most secure investments available in the U.S. market, with no risk of issuer default.

H3: How liquid are they?
They can be sold or redeemed before maturity through Fidelity’s user-friendly platform, offering regular liquidity with minimal transaction friction.

H3: What returns do Treasury Bills typically offer?
Returns vary monthly based on federal short-term rates, offering competitive yields relative to savings accounts—ideal for preserving purchasing power during rate fluctuations.
